The camera and the museum are incompatible?

When visiting museums and galleries, guests are very confused. Is shooting allowed or not? Sometimes it is somehow awkward and inconvenient to approach and ask strict caretakers. And, being in the Tretyakov Gallery, everything immediately flies out of my head, and the hand itself reaches for the phone.

You can breathe out calmly! At the Tretyakov Gallery But you need to be careful. It is allowed to photograph only the permanent exhibitions of the gallery and the New Tretyakov Gallery, as well as in other buildings of the museum. If there is a temporary exhibition, photography and filming may be prohibited because the law on the protection of copyright and intellectual property comes into force.

When taking photographs, it is recommended not to inconvenience other visitors. Do everything carefully and wisely. And, of course, do not forget to check the price for this pleasure at the ticket office of the museum.

There is an interesting and unique opportunity to conduct professional photography in the Tretyakov Gallery, but for this you need to contact the museum's press service.

Flash is the main enemy

One of the important reminders. Shooting is allowed, but without a flash and without the use of any special equipment (even a selfie stick, alas, is prohibited). The fact is that the light from the flash can be too dangerous and harmful for works of art. Ultimately, it can damage them and lead to "premature aging". Also, the flash distracts employees and visitors of the museum, making it difficult for the first to follow the hall, and the second - to focus on the work of art.

And finally, interesting facts and tips

  1. Many people think that the famous painting by I. K. Aivazovsky's "Ninth Wave" is kept in the Tretyakov Gallery, but this is a delusion! She is in the Russian Museum of St. Petersburg.
  2. If you are a fan of Crimea, and finances do not yet allow you to visit it, then we are glad to announce that in the gallery you can enjoy the paintings of I. I. Levitan from the series "Crimean Landscapes".
